About Quantumscape Corp
QuantumScape is pursuing solid-state lithium-metal battery technology that replaces the liquid electrolyte and graphite anode of conventional lithium-ion cells with a solid ceramic separator and a lithium-metal anode. The intended result: batteries that charge faster, store more energy per kilogram, and eliminate the flammable liquid that drives many safety concerns in today's EV packs. The technology remains in the pre-commercial phase, with multi-layer prototype cells undergoing testing and a pilot manufacturing line validating production processes. A joint venture with a major European automaker provides both investment capital and a pathway to vehicle integration. The ceramic separator is the enabling component: it must conduct lithium ions efficiently, resist dendrite penetration over thousands of charge cycles, and be manufactured in large sheets at automotive-grade consistency.
